Which Bridgerton Will Take Center Stage?

A central question surrounding Season 5 is: which sibling will lead the story this time? Each season of Bridgerton adapts a different novel from Julia Quinn’s book series, focusing on a new romantic pairing. While Netflix has yet to officially confirm the next protagonist, fan theories are already running wild.

Many believe that Eloise Bridgerton could finally step into the spotlight, given her evolving character arc and growing independence. Others argue that Benedict Bridgerton remains the most likely choice, especially considering the groundwork laid in previous seasons.
